Ethiopia’s Tigst Assefa Sets New Women’s World Record At Berlin Marathon
The 26-year-old runner finished in a new world record time of two hours, 11 minutes, and 53 seconds, successfully defending the title she won the previous year.

England Golf Is Trying Scale Up The Number of Women In Golf
Women on Par and Girls Golf Rocks are two programs run by England Golf, the national governing body for amateur golf, that aim to introduce young women (ages five to eighteen) to the game of golf in a positive and encouraging environment.
